Which of the following statement is true? i) Using singly linked lists and circular list, it is not efficient to traverse the list backwards i) To find the predecessor( previous), it is required to traverse the list from the first node in case of singly linked list. Select one: Oa i-only Ob ) only Oe Both i and i Od None of both
Q: Fill-in-the-Blank __________ a node means adding it to a list, but not necessarily to the end.
A:
Q: 19.17 LAB: Doubly linked list In this lab you are asked to complete the program to do the following:…
A: Here I have defined the function swap(). Inside the function, I have checked if the node is none or…
Q: True/False You can perform reduce operation with a list comprehension Looking for even numbers in a…
A: 1. List comprehension offers a shorter syntax when you want to create a new list based on the values…
Q: Several of the programming exercises in this section ask you to find the mean and median value in a…
A: #include <iostream> using namespace std; int main() { int a[100]; int i,n; float…
Q: True or False For each statement below, indicate whether you think it is True or False. If you…
A:
Q: 1) Create the Circular Linked List below. 2) Generate a random integer value N. [1..15] 3) Starting…
A: According to the information given:- We have to follow the instruction in order to create Circular…
Q: True or False? In a non-empty list, the item that has been in the list the longest will be returned…
A: False Get operation on a list returns the element that is present at the index passed as a parameter…
Q: language : c++ question : Create a doubly circular linked list. Write a function in doubly…
A: #include <bits/stdc++.h>using namespace std; // Structure of a Nodestruct Node{ int data;…
Q: Task 16: The Linked List contains certain Nodes containing data of integer type, You cannot use any…
A: C++ program: #include<bits/stdc++.h> using namespace std; struct node { int data; struct…
Q: 6. __________ a node means adding it to the end of a list.
A: Appending
Q: Question1:- Write a C++ code to insert the following numbers in the Linked List. 5, 78, 45, 11, 89,…
A: //Necessary header files#include <iostream>using namespace std; // Implementation of linked…
Q: Instruction draw the three (3) types of linked list. Make sure the elements or nodes are related…
A: Let's understand step by step : 1. Singly linked list A singly linked list can be traversed only…
Q: def longest_chain (lst: List[int]) -> int: Given a list of integers, return the length of the…
A: Please refer to the following steps for the complete solution to the problem above.
Q: Fill-in blank the correct term Each node in a list consists of at least .parts .....
A: Linked list is a data structure. each node in a list consist of at least two parts.
Q: 1. Create a program that will do the following operations using linked list: • Insert(k): adds k to…
A: LinkedList is a linear data structure that uses references or pointers to point to the next node.…
Q: Module 5: Merge Sort Merge Sort works by continuously partitioning a list into two smaller sub-lists…
A: Given Merge sort working process
Q: Purpose: The purpose of this: Design and develop Applications that incorporate fundamental…
A: answer:-
Q: debugg help def print_categories(main_list): if id not in main_list: print("There…
A: Algorithm: Read the list and display the main list. Read the index and check whether the index is…
Q: 1. Lists, comprehensions, loops and slicing. Save it as threeLists.py. a) Create a list…
A: EXPLANATION: - The list comprehension is used to create a list having all multiples of 4 from 0…
Q: Linked List traversal function that create a list and print the data of each node. Select one: True…
A: Ans: True that linked list traversal function that create a list and print the data of each node.
Q: 1. 1 2 NULL Write a code that contains the followings: Construct the Linked List
A: Given: Write a code that contains the following: Construct the linked list
Q: Perform this Task by sing C++ Langage... Your task is to develop a program for a hospital where…
A: #include <iostream>using namespace std;//Date Class used storing datesclass…
Q: C++ programming It’s my humble request don’t use chegg Given a set of integer values of size n (each…
A: Selection Sort Algorithm: Iterate the given list N times where N is the number of elements in the…
Q: 2.3: Operations on two lists Let's try operating on two lists at a time. Compute the "dot product",…
A: In this question we have given two iterables of any type and we need to find the dot product of the…
Q: nsider a singly linked list of the form Y create a new node as shown below; ew node(); a=100; h is…
A: SUMMARY: - Hence, we discussed all the points.
Q: n a linked list. Please use C
A: given - 1. Write a simple procedure to count the number of elements in a linked list. Please use C
Q: for c++ please thank you please type the code so i can copy and paste easily thanks. 4, List…
A: // ============================================================= // This is the header file of…
Q: rite this? Thanks! NumberList.cpp // Implementation file for the NumberList class #include //…
A: Question Can you write this? Thanks! NumberList.cpp // Implementation file…
Q: After doing the following statement, the linked list becomes Head = P Head 3000 4800 10 4900 15 5000…
A: link list question
Q: Q9. * After doing the following statement, the linked list becomes Head P.Link
A: => i have provided this answer with full description in step-2.
Q: Fill-in-the-Blank __________ a node means adding it to the end of a list.
A: Explanation Appending a node implies that a new node is added to the end of the list. Inserting a…
Q: write a C++ complete code of the Linked-List Linked List must contain the following functions: a.…
A:
Q: 7. A code segment is intended to transform the list utensils so that the last element of the list is…
A: The given question asks for to remove last element of the list and inset the removed element at 1st…
Q: After doing the following statement, the linked list becomes Head P Head 3000 4800 10 4900 15 5000…
A: Here in this question we have given a linked list with an operation to do on this.and We have asked…
Q: public void Unknown() { if (size cur = head; Node prev = tail; for(int i=0; i < size/2; i++) {…
A: Ans : Assume this method is given within the KWArrayList class ,the answer that is correct is : c)…
Q: Write a program to delete a node with the minimum value from a singly linked list.
A: C++ program to delete a node with the minimum value from a singly linked list: #include…
Q: T/F: All Linked Lists must have head node.
A: Linked List : The linked list is a heterogeneous data structure that stores data elements of…
Q: def find_positive_value_coordinates(lst: list[list[int]]) -> list[list[int]]: "" Takes in a nested…
A: Blank 1: for i in range(len(lst)): Blank2: for j in range(len(lst[i])):
Q: Lists, comprehensions, loops and slicing. a) Create a list comprehension of multiples of 4 from 0 to…
A: Algorithm : Step 1 : use list comprehension to create the first list. Step 2 : print the list. Step…
Q: List operations: Add something to the end of a list, remove something from the end of a list, add…
A: Here, I have to provide a solution to the above question.
Q: Singly-linked list & doubly-linked list What is the difference between a singly-linked list and…
A: There is no numbering in the question and only one question is numbered as “2”. I have considered…
Q: 3.Create a linked list with given numbers in which info part of each node contains the digit of this…
A: The Code along with output given below Approach is to take input by user as string(so that a long…
Q: create list consist of odd numbers ] # create list consist of even numbers ] # do mathematical…
A: odd = [3,7,5,23,57,21,13,31,27] even = [2,4,12,32,16,48,34,42,18,30] print(odd+even)…
Q: ... requires more memory space than... Doubly Linked List Doubly Circular Linked List
A: . ......... requires more memory space than ......... ODoubly Linked ListODoubly Circular Linked…
Q: Purpose: The purpose of this: Design and develop Applications that incorporate fundamental…
A: //CODE class Node { int data; Node next; Node(int d) { data =…
Q: ure that takes a tree (represented as a list) and returns a list whose elements are all the leaves…
A: Scheme code (define (leaves items)(cond ((null? items) items)((not (pair? items)) (list items))(else…
Q: Fill-in blank the correct term Each node in a list consists of at least ..parts
A: Answer
Q: that gets a a paramet ate from that list. At the end return the new list. Do not use dictionary…
A: Main logic: - i = 0 while i < len(a): j = i + 1 while j < len(a): if…
Q: Give an example for unordered list.
A: According to the Question below the solution
Trending now
This is a popular solution!
Step by step
Solved in 2 steps
- Getring error fix asap Given a Singly Linked List of integers, delete all the alternate nodes in the list.Example:List: 10 -> 20 -> 30 -> 40 -> 50 -> 60 -> nullAlternate nodes will be: 20, 40, and 60. Hence after deleting, the list will be:Output: 10 -> 30 -> 50 -> nullNote :The head of the list will remain the same. Don't need to print or return anything.Input format :The first and the only line of input will contain the elements of the Singly Linked List separated by a single space and terminated by -1.Output Format :The only line of output will contain the updated list elements.Input Constraints:1 <= N <= 10 ^ 6.Where N is the size of the Singly Linked List Time Limit: 1 secSample Input 1:1 2 3 4 5 -1Sample Output 1:1 3 5Explanation of Sample Input 1:2, 4 are alternate nodes so we need to delete them Sample Input 2:10 20 30 40 50 60 70 -1Sample Output 2:10 30 50 70. .Points to be noted: **Please use Python 3 and do not use any built-in function **Do not just copy paste from any other sources, come up with an unique solution. **Solve the above problem using a linked list based stack.struct node{int num;node *next, *before;};start 18 27 36 45 54 63 The above-linked list is made of nodes of the type struct ex. Your task is now to Write a complete function code to a. Find the sum of all the values of the node in the linked list. b. Print the values in the linked list in reverse order. Use a temporary pointer temp for a and b. i dont need a full code just the list part
- Please help with program I will post instructions. REQUIREMENTS: Using Python, you will write a program called singly-linked-list-arrays.py that implements an ordered singly-linked list using arrays. The data items in your ordered singly-linked list will consist of first names. For example: Adam, Eve, Frank, Mark, Vanessa, etc. Be sure to include the following linked list operations in your Python program: GetNode(FreeNodes) returns the index of the first available (free) node as indicated in the FreeNodes boolean array. If there are no available (free) nodes, then returns -1. InsertNode(Data, Link, FreeNodes, newNode, headPtr) inserts a newNode into the linked list, referenced by headPtr, as represented using the Data and Link arrays.The index of the corresponding FreeNode array element is assigned the value of False, indicating that this node is no longer considered "free." Returns +1 if successfully inserted into the list, otherwise returns -1. DeleteNode(Data, Link, FreeNodes,…_!?8. Problem Title: "Add Two Numb You are given two non-empty linked lists representing two non-negative integers. The digits are stored in reverse order, and each of their nodes contains a single digit. Add the two numbers and return the sum as a linked list. You may assume the two numbers do not contain any leading zero, except the number 0 itself..write a C++ complete code of the Linked-ListLinked List must contain the following functions:a. Insertion( )b. Display( )c. Append( )d. Delete( )e. Update( )
- Can someone help me with this? C++ programming please! Given the MileageTrackerNode class, complete main() to insert nodes into a linked list (using the InsertAfter() function). The first user-input value is the number of nodes in the linked list. Use the PrintNodeData() function to print the entire linked list. DO NOT print the dummy head node. Ex. If the input is: 3 2.2 7/2/18 3.2 7/7/18 4.5 7/16/18 the output is: 2.2, 7/2/18 3.2, 7/7/18 4.5, 7/16/18 Main.cpp #include "MileageTrackerNode.h"#include <string>#include <iostream>using namespace std; int main (int argc, char* argv[]) {// References for MileageTrackerNode objectsMileageTrackerNode* headNode;MileageTrackerNode* currNode;MileageTrackerNode* lastNode; double miles;string date;int i; // Front of nodes listheadNode = new MileageTrackerNode();lastNode = headNode; // TODO: Read in the number of nodes // TODO: For the read in number of nodes, read// in data and insert into the linked list // TODO: Call the…Please fill in the blanks from 26 to 78 in C. /*This program will print students’ information and remove students using linked list*/ #include<stdio.h> #include<stdlib.h> //Declare a struct student (node) with 5 members //each student node contains an ID, an age, graduation year, // 1 pointer points to the next student, and 1 pointer points to the previous student. struct student { int ID; int age; int classOf; struct student* next; struct student* prev; }; /* - This function takes the head pointer and iterates through the list to get all 3 integers needed from the user, and save it to our list - Update the pointer to point to the next node.*/ void scanLL(struct student* head) { while(head != NULL) //this condition makes sure the list is not at the end { printf("Lets fill in the information. Enter 3 integers for the student's ID, age, and graduation year: "); scanf("%i %i %i",&&head->ID, &head->age, &head->classOf); //in order: ID, age, graduation…Assume the Doubly Linked List as follows, please write a code to deleted a data node from the list and show the result of each line of code in step-by-step manner
- 6. Take a input from a user and create a doubly linked list and then find the largest element in a doubly linked list. Use 1 to take more inputs from user else enter another number. Use C language and attach output.True/False Select true or false for the statements below. Explain your answers if you like to receive partial credit. 3) Which of the following is true about the insertBeforeCurrent function for a CircularLinked List (CLL) like you did in programming exercise 1?a. If the CLL is empty, you need to create the new node, set it to current, andhave its next pointer refer to itselfb. The worst case performance of the function is O(n)c. If you insert a new element with the same data value as the current node, theperformance improves to O(log n)JAVA CODE PLEASE Linked List Practice ll by CodeChum Admin Write a function printNodes that takes in the head of a linked list and prints all the values of that linked list using a while loop. Print the values separated by a [space]->[space] In the main function, write a program that asks the user to input five integers and assign these values to the nodes. Arrange the nodes in ascending order first before printing them using the printNodes function. Input 1. One line containing an integer 2. One line containing an integer 3. One line containing an integer 4. One line containing an integer 5. One line containing an integer Output Enter·number·1:·1 Enter·number·2:·2 Enter·number·3:·3 Enter·number·4:·4 Enter·number·5:·5 1·->·2·->·3·->·4·->·5